Four million Italians go back to work amid confusion and frustration over new rules

Millions of Italians head back to work today amid mounting frustration and confusion over the government’s “Phase 2” plan for easing lockdown restrictions.
On Sunday, the government issued guidelines to law enforcement agencies urging “prudent and fair” policing of new rules and restrictions on movements, which start today and will remain in place until May 17.
But as regions pass their own tailor-made regulatory acts, Italians complain of an increasingly complicated patchwork of “do’s and don’ts.”
Italy has one of the world's highest death tolls, with almost 29,000 deaths from Covid-19 since the outbreak began in mid-February.
